The Latest Senior Living Community Resident Arrest Made After Parking Lot Fight.

DELRAY BEACH, FL (BocaNewsNow.com) (Copyright © 2026 MetroDesk Media, LLC) — If you’re looking for alleged criminals in Palm Beach County, you can look in the Palm Beach County, or you can look in the senior living community of Kings Point. At least 90 residents have been arrested since the start of 2023. The sixth arrest of 2026 was just made.
Ryan Narron, 37, was taken into custody on Sunday. It’s unclear why a 37-year-old is listing Kings Point as his residential address. He, however, lists the Burgany I section of the senior community as home.
Narron, according to a police report reviewed by BocaNewsNow.com, got into a pushing altercation with another person in a Kings Point parking lot. The altercation was allegedly recorded and provided to the Palm Beach County Sheriff’s Office which made the arrest. He is charged with battery. Narron was booked into the Palm Beach County Jail and later released on $1,000 bond.

Nation’s arrest brings the Kings Point Alleged Criminal Count to six for 2026, 41 since the start of 2025. 90 since the start of 2023. Among the arrestees: residents charged with sex crimes, violent crimes, domestic violence, child sex crimes, weapons offenses, DUI, drug possession and distribution, and more. Unofficial records maintained by BocaNewsNow.com suggest there is no other senior living community in South Palm Beach County that logs more resident arrests than Kings Point.
